What Happens If Rain Gutters Are Not Kept Clean?
Gutters ought to be cleaned at least twice a year to guarantee maximum performance and longevity.
American Society of Home Inspectors states: "Like all other components and systems in your home, gutters require regular maintenance to ensure they are working properly."
In colder climates, the water trapped in gutters can freeze. This results in the formation of ice dams, which can damage the gutters and even lead to leaks inside the property by pushing ice under roof shingles.
Moreover, the added weight of debris and trapped water can cause gutters to sag or break away from their attachments. Neglecting to keep your gutters clean can lead to structural, aesthetic, and health issues, emphasizing the importance of regular maintenance.

Guidelines For Cleaning Frequency
Residential Property:
If you don’t have any trees around the property, an annual cleaning should be sufficient. If you have several trees, you will need to have them cleaned at least 2 times per year. If you have a lot of trees, you would need them cleaned no less than four times per year.
Industrial Or Commercial Property:
Most industrial and commercial properties are fine with an annual cleaning, but care needs to be taken if there are trees around the property.
Apartment Or Condo:
Our general suggestion for most apartments and condos is to have the gutters cleaned on a semi-annual basis. On average, these types of properties contain more trees than industrial or commercial properties but generally less than residential properties.

How Much Does Gutter Cleaning Cost In White Pine?
Size of Your Property
The price of gutter cleaning services often changes depending upon the length of gutters found on a home. Of course, larger sized homes with more extensive gutter systems may well be subject to elevated fees because of the increased workload and time taken.
Complexity of the Guttering System
A more involved gutter system, defined by numerous bends, a number of levels, or distinct designs, will have an effect on the expense. The level of difficulty rises with complexity, demanding specialized tools or methods for thorough cleaning.
Accessibility
The ease of access of your gutters plays a pivotal part in determining the price. Gutters that are more difficult to reach, possibly due to landscaping or architectural barriers, can make the task more challenging, affecting the general rate of the service.
Height of the Building
The height of a building can specifically determine the price. Gutter cleaning services for taller buildings normally come at a premium, mostly because of the added risks and tools called for to reach greater elevations.
Condition of the Gutters and Downspouts
Gutters in a state of considerable neglect, swelling with blockages and sediment, might increase the price. The reason being, they mandate more extensive cleaning and possibly minor repairs.
Time Of Year
The time of the year that you have your gutters cleaned out can affect the price of the cleaning due to several factors, including staffing, weather patterns, urgency required, etc.

Important Facts About Rain Gutters and Gutter Cleaning
What Do Rain Gutters Do?
Rain gutters take in water from the roofing, directing it away from the foundation to prevent possible damage. Their basic purpose is to shield the home's structural integrity by guaranteeing water drains properly, defending against accumulation and the adverse repercussions of mold and mildew. In addition, by retaining a clean channel for water, gutters defend against debris like leaves, branches, twigs, and dirt from settling on roofing shingles.
University of Californian Department of Agriculture and Natural Resources states: “Gutters play a role in providing a means of collecting and directing rainwater from the roof into downspouts, and then away from the house.”
In the US, up to .044 gallons (200 milliliters) of rain can fall per minute per square foot of roof area. On a 2000-square-foot roof, that’s 88 gallons (400 liters) of rainwater per minute!
How Do Gutters and Downspouts Get Clogged?
Gutters and downspouts eventually become plugged predominantly due to the accumulation of deb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t. Gradually, these materials collect and stop the movement of water, resulting in backups. Pests and rodents can also bring about blockages, building nests and leaving waste. In addition, in cold environments, snow and ice can be an aspect; as they melt and refreeze, they can slow down the typical water flow.
The causes of clogged gutters and downspouts are varying, however knowing them is crucial to guaranteeing proper home care.
What are the Consequences of Clogged Gutters?
Water Damage: Overflowing rainwater can destroy the home's siding, fascia, and foundation.
Roofing Damage: Pooled water can rot wood roof structures and damage roofing shingles.
Basement Flooding: Poor drainage can lead to water pile-up around the foundation, triggering basements to flood.
Pest Infestations: Stagnant water draws in pests like mosquitoes, rodents, and wasps.
Landscape Erosion: Overflows can wear away gardens and ruin plants.
Mold and Mildew Growth: Moist environments assist in the progression of mold and mildew, which may be hazardous to health.
Gutter Damage: The weight of trapped debris can cause gutters to droop, pull away, or maybe crack.
Ice Dams: In colder climates, trapped water can solidify and form ice dams that further prevent water flow.
Decreased Property Value: Structural and aesthetic damages as a result of clogged up gutters can decrease the home's resale value.
Taking care of gutter stoppages promptly is crucial to prevent these detrimental effects on your home.
How Can You Tell Your Gutters are Blocked?
- Overflowing Water: When it storms, rainwater spills over the edges of the gutters as opposed to continuing through downspouts.
- Sagging Gutters: Excess weight from trapped debris can cause gutters to droop or bend.
- Stagnant Water Pools: Places of standing water or moist patches near the foundation of your house.
- Birds or Pests: Recurring activity of birds, pests, or insects near your gutters might be an indication of nesting or standing water.
- Visible Debris: Overhanging leaves, branches, or other debris standing out from the top of gutters.
- Plants Growing: Little plants or weeds shooting up from the gutters.
- Drips or Sounds: The sound of dripping or trickling water from gutters when it's not raining.
- Stains on Siding: Watermarks, mold, or mildew on the siding of your residence, particularly below the gutters.
- Eroded Landscape: Gully development or destroyed landscaping straight below the gutters.
- Peeling Paint: Peeling or bubbling paint on your home near the gutters due to consistent water exposure.

Do Gutter Guards Help In Reducing Blockages?
A gutter guard is a protective mesh or cover created to stop leaves, debris, and bugs from going into and obstructing the gutters. Unfortunately, while the concept sounds beneficial, there are drawbacks to take into consideration. To start with, the initial price of installation can be excessive for many homeowners. Secondly, a substantial number of products on in the marketplace do not perform as advertised, making it possible for debris to build up or triggering water to overfill the gutters..
